OT: My first Auto X.....
All I can say is daaaaamn.. It was awsome I had so much fun and the people there were super nice. Anyways on with the race. I was in the Street Touring Class (STS) and I ended up 2nd after the two day event being 2 sec behind the 1st place guy. But it was dope and I would never of imagined it could be such an experience and so overwhelming sitting there driving through the course. If you have never done it and are even the slightest bit interested in it definitely give it a try, and you wont be dissapointed...

MechE00... yeah this was a 2 day event.. It was a divisional event.
The course was being run in 38 seconds by the modded cars with the DOT approved race tires. I ran it in a 44.67 with my kumho 712's and almost stock teg (just CAI and eibach sportlines) .
And finally yes I am addicted .. and I am in the process of finding out more about some events closer to me.. this event was only 70 miles, but it is the only one at that location every year the others are about a 4-5 hr drive. And yes I need some spare rims and some of those sticky *** tires..
